Transform Your Space with a DIY Drop Ceiling

Drop ceilings, also known as suspended ceilings, offer a practical and stylish way to redefine interior spaces. They are secondary ceilings hung below the main structural ceiling, creating a cavity that serves multiple purposes beyond just aesthetics. They’ve become a popular choice for homeowners and businesses alike, and for good reason.

What exactly is it that makes drop ceilings so appealing?

Defining the Drop Ceiling

At its core, a drop ceiling is a grid of metal framework suspended from the original ceiling. Into this grid, lightweight panels or drop ceiling tiles are placed. These tiles are easily removable, granting access to the space above for maintenance or upgrades to wiring, plumbing, or HVAC systems.

This accessibility is a major advantage over traditional drywall ceilings.

The Multi-faceted Benefits of Drop Ceilings

Beyond their basic structure, drop ceilings offer a wealth of benefits:

  • Aesthetic Enhancement: Drop ceilings provide a clean, uniform look, instantly modernizing a space. A wide array of tile styles, textures, and colors are available, enabling customization to match any design aesthetic.

  • Concealing Unsightly Elements: One of the most significant advantages is the ability to hide unsightly elements like exposed pipes, ductwork, and wiring. This creates a more polished and professional appearance.

  • Acoustic Advantages: Certain drop ceiling tiles offer excellent sound absorption properties. This is particularly useful in spaces where noise reduction is desired, such as offices, classrooms, or home theaters. This reduces reverberation and improves overall sound quality.

  • Thermal Insulation: The air space created between the original ceiling and the drop ceiling can act as an insulator, helping to reduce energy costs by maintaining a more consistent temperature.

  • Easy Access for Maintenance: As previously mentioned, drop ceilings allow for easy access to the area above, making maintenance and repairs of essential services significantly simpler and more cost-effective.

Material Selection: Tiles and Grid Components

With a clear understanding of your space, you can now turn your attention to selecting the appropriate materials. This involves choosing the right drop ceiling tiles and suspension grid components to meet your aesthetic and functional requirements.

Choosing Drop Ceiling Tiles

Drop ceiling tiles come in a wide variety of materials, styles, sizes, and colors. Consider factors such as:

  • Material: Mineral fiber, fiberglass, and vinyl are common choices, each offering different levels of sound absorption, moisture resistance, and durability.
  • Style: From classic white to textured patterns and decorative designs, choose a style that complements your overall aesthetic.
  • Size: Standard sizes are typically 2x2 feet or 2x4 feet, but other options may be available.
  • Fire Rating: Ensure the tiles meet local building codes and fire safety requirements.

Selecting Suspension Grid Components

The suspension grid is the framework that supports the drop ceiling tiles. It consists of:

  • Main Runners: These are the primary support beams that run the length of the room.
  • Cross Tees: These connect to the main runners, forming a grid pattern.
  • Wall Angle: This is attached to the walls around the perimeter of the room, providing support for the edges of the tiles.

When selecting grid components, consider the load-bearing capacity and the overall aesthetic. Choose a finish that complements the tiles.

Calculating Material Quantities

Accurately calculating the required quantities of main runners, cross tees, and wall angle is essential to avoid shortages or excess materials.

  • Wall Angle: Calculate the perimeter of the room to determine the total length of wall angle needed.
  • Main Runners & Cross Tees: Consult manufacturer guidelines or online calculators to determine the appropriate spacing and quantity based on the room dimensions and tile size. Always add a small percentage (5-10%) to account for waste and cuts.

Preparing the Perimeter: Attaching the Wall Angle

The wall angle forms the foundation of your drop ceiling, providing a level support for the entire grid system. Getting this step right is paramount.

Marking the Ceiling Height

Begin by marking the desired ceiling height around the entire perimeter of the room. A laser level is invaluable for this task, projecting a perfectly horizontal line for accurate marking. If you don't have a laser level, a traditional level and a long, straight edge will work, but the process will be more time-consuming.

Make sure to account for any existing obstructions, such as door or window frames, and adjust the height accordingly to maintain a consistent and visually appealing look. Use a pencil or marker to create clear, visible marks along the walls, spaced every few feet.

Attaching the Wall Angle

With your height marks in place, it's time to attach the wall angle. Position the wall angle so its top edge aligns with your marked line. Pre-drill pilot holes through the wall angle and into the wall to prevent splitting the material and make screwing easier.

The type of fastener you use will depend on the wall material. Use drywall screws for drywall, concrete screws for concrete or masonry, and appropriate wood screws for wood framing. Ensure the wall angle is securely fastened to the wall, with screws placed every 12-18 inches.

Double-check the level of the installed wall angle frequently using your level. Slight adjustments may be necessary to ensure a perfectly level perimeter. Remember, a level perimeter is essential for a professional-looking drop ceiling.

Installing the Suspension Grid: Main Runners and Cross Tees

With the wall angle securely in place, you can now begin assembling the suspension grid, which will support the drop ceiling tiles. This involves hanging the main runners and connecting the cross tees to create a network of intersecting supports.

Hanging the Main Runners

The main runners are the primary supports of the grid system, running the length of the room and suspended from the existing ceiling joists. To hang them, use hanging wire attached to the joists above. The spacing between the main runners will depend on the size of your drop ceiling tiles, so consult the manufacturer's instructions.

Attach the hanging wire to the ceiling joists using screws or appropriate fasteners. Run the wire down to the main runner and create a secure loop, ensuring the main runner hangs at the correct height. Use a level to verify that each main runner is level and properly supported before moving on.

Consistency in the spacing and height of the main runners is key to a level and aesthetically pleasing ceiling. Use a measuring tape and level frequently to ensure accuracy.

Connecting the Cross Tees

The cross tees connect to the main runners, forming the grid pattern that will hold the drop ceiling tiles. They typically snap into pre-cut slots on the main runners. Ensure the cross tees are securely connected and that the grid pattern is uniform throughout the room.

Again, use a level to verify that the cross tees are level and aligned with the main runners. Make any necessary adjustments to ensure a perfectly level and secure grid structure. The stability of your finished ceiling depends on a well-constructed grid.

Before proceeding, double-check that the entire suspension grid is level and secure. Any issues at this stage will be magnified once the drop ceiling tiles are installed.

Laying the Drop Ceiling Tiles: Completing the Ceiling Surface

With the suspension grid complete, you're ready for the final step: laying in the drop ceiling tiles. This is where your hard work pays off, and your new ceiling begins to take shape.

Placing the Tiles

Carefully lift each drop ceiling tile and gently place it into the grid. Ensure the tile is properly aligned and seated, with its edges resting securely on the cross tees and wall angle.

Work your way across the room, installing each drop ceiling tile in turn. Pay attention to the alignment and spacing of the tiles, making sure they fit snugly within the grid.

Cutting Tiles for Obstacles

In most rooms, you'll encounter obstacles such as light fixtures, pipes, or HVAC ducts that require you to cut the drop ceiling tiles. Use a utility knife to score the tile along the desired cutting line. Then, gently snap the tile along the score line.

For more complex cuts, use a drywall saw or jigsaw to create the necessary shape. Take your time and make accurate cuts to minimize waste and ensure a professional-looking finish.

When cutting tiles, always err on the side of making the cut slightly too large rather than too small. You can always trim away excess material, but you can't add it back. Practice your cuts on scrap pieces of tile to get a feel for the material.

Installing Lighting: Illuminating Your New Space

Proper lighting can dramatically enhance the look and feel of your drop ceiling. Planning your lighting strategy before you install the grid is ideal, but it's often possible to add or modify lighting later.

Choosing the Right Fixtures

Recessed lights, also known as can lights or pot lights, are a popular choice for drop ceilings due to their sleek, integrated appearance.

They sit flush with the tile surface, providing even and unobtrusive illumination.

Fluorescent lights, particularly LED tubes designed to fit standard fluorescent fixtures, offer energy efficiency and a wide range of color temperatures.

Surface-mounted fixtures can also be used, but require careful consideration of weight distribution and grid support.

Wiring and Electrical Safety

Safety is paramount when working with electricity. Always disconnect the power at the circuit breaker before handling any wiring.

If you're not comfortable working with electrical wiring, hire a qualified electrician.

Check and strictly adhere to all local electrical codes and regulations. These codes are in place to protect you and your property.

Connecting your chosen lighting fixture to the power source requires careful attention to wire connections and grounding. Use appropriate wire connectors and ensure all connections are secure.

Supporting Your Lighting Fixtures

Drop ceiling grids are designed to support the weight of the tiles, but heavy lighting fixtures may require additional support.

Independent support wires attached to the building structure above are recommended for heavier fixtures.

These wires should be securely fastened to both the fixture and a structural element, such as a joist or beam.

Consider using specialized grid clips designed to support lighting fixtures, distributing the weight more evenly across the grid system.

Addressing Potential Issues: Achieving a Flawless Finish

Even with careful planning and installation, minor issues can arise. Addressing them promptly ensures a professional and long-lasting drop ceiling.

Troubleshooting Common Problems

  • Uneven Tiles: This could indicate an unlevel grid or tiles that aren't properly seated. Double-check the grid with a level and ensure each tile is fully engaged with the grid's edges. Slight variations in tile thickness can also contribute to unevenness.

  • Sagging Grids: Sagging usually results from insufficient support or overloading the grid. Ensure hanging wires are correctly spaced and securely attached to both the grid and the structure above. Avoid placing excessive weight on the grid, especially near light fixtures.

  • Gaps: Gaps between tiles or along the perimeter can detract from the overall appearance. Check for improperly cut tiles or inconsistencies in grid spacing.

Solutions and Fine-Tuning

  • Adjusting Tile Placement: Carefully lift and reposition tiles to ensure a snug and even fit. Use shims if necessary to compensate for slight variations in tile thickness.

  • Adding Support Wires: For sagging grids, install additional support wires to reinforce the structure. Distribute the added support evenly across the affected area.

  • Cutting Replacement Tiles: For gaps caused by incorrect cuts, measure the required size and carefully cut a replacement tile using a utility knife and a straight edge.

Sealing Gaps for Improved Insulation and Aesthetics

Sealing gaps and cracks can improve both the insulation and the appearance of your drop ceiling.

Use a paintable caulk or sealant to fill any noticeable gaps along the perimeter where the wall angle meets the wall.

This creates a clean, finished look and helps prevent drafts.

For small gaps between tiles, consider using a color-matched sealant designed for drop ceilings. Apply sparingly and wipe away any excess immediately for a seamless blend.

Drop Ceiling Installation: FAQs

Here are some frequently asked questions to help you with your drop ceiling installation project.

How much does it generally cost to install a drop ceiling?

The cost of installing a drop ceiling varies depending on the size of the room, the type of tiles you choose, and whether you hire a professional or do it yourself. Expect material costs ranging from $2 to $5 per square foot. Labor can significantly increase the price.

What tools are absolutely essential for a DIY drop ceiling install?

Essential tools include a measuring tape, level, laser level (optional but recommended), safety glasses, tin snips, a drill, and a utility knife. A chalk line will also be helpful for marking straight lines. These tools are crucial for accurately installing your drop ceiling.

What if my room isn't perfectly square? Will that affect installing the drop ceiling?

Yes, an out-of-square room will require careful planning and precise cuts when installing the drop ceiling. Ensure accurate measurements and use your tin snips to make precise cuts for the perimeter tiles. A laser level can be especially helpful in this situation.

How much clearance do I need above the existing ceiling to install a drop ceiling?

Generally, you need at least 3-4 inches of clearance above the existing ceiling to accommodate the suspension grid and tiles when installing a drop ceiling. Check your local building codes for specific requirements in your area. You want enough room to maneuver comfortably.
